Lamellar Ichthyosis Market Estimated to Soar Driven by Genetic Research

The Lamellar Ichthyosis Market encompasses a range of therapeutic products designed to manage the chronic and severe scaling associated with lamellar ichthyosis, a rare genetic skin disorder. Key offerings include systemic retinoids, topical emollients, keratolytic agents, and emerging gene therapies. Systemic retinoids, such as acitretin, provide significant advantages by reducing hyperkeratosis and improving skin flexibility, while topical moisturizers help maintain barrier function and prevent infections.

Latest innovations in gene editing and targeted biologics address root genetic mutations, paving the way for personalized treatment regimens.
